What companies run services between Newcastle-under-Lyme, England and Derby, England?

East Midlands Railways operates a train from Stoke-on-Trent to Derby hourly. Tickets cost £18–27 and the journey takes 52 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from bus station to Friar Gate via Bus Station in around 2h 44m.
